## Onboarding: GPU Memory Profiling with Heapscope

Hey, welcome to the Vantora perf team! Most of your first week will involve Heapscope, our in-house GPU memory profiler. It snapshots allocations per kernel launch and flags fragmentation before OOMs bite. Run it against the staging trainer first — production captures need sign-off. Docs live in the team wiki; start with the "reading flame views" page. To pull profiling traces from the secured artifact store, the tool will ask for the recovery passphrase noted just below.

unlock words, fafop-hawep: briwyn-oliix-sorox

Subject: First-aid room — ground floor

All new starters: the first-aid room is on the ground floor of Brennan Court, behind the lifts. Kit is restocked weekly. Do not remove supplies for desk use. If the room is occupied, wait outside — don't knock twice. Report any incident to the front desk afterwards. The door-pass code for the room is below.

door code, yagap-bahof: bdg-O-05

## Ownership

The color-contrast audit for the Lumenpane dashboard runs quarterly against WCAG AA thresholds. Results land in the `a11y-reports` folder; failures must be triaged within two sprints. Tooling config lives in `contrast.config.js` and should not be edited without review. If the audit pipeline breaks or thresholds need updating, contact the designated accessibility owner listed below.

approver of faduf-bagug = Framir Sorwyn